This song reminds me of the movie "Blade Runner." Especially these lyrics:
"Now I heard man-machine say, 'We're just tears in rain.' "
Which echoes the android in the movie who says, "All those ... moments will be lost in time, like tears...in rain."
Also, all the references in the song to memories, which were a major part of the film. The lyrics "I know there's a way To keep these gears from rusting But my memory grows dusty And the muscle falls away."
seem to describe the search of the androids for a way to extend their four-year lifespan, even as they are dying.
Is this a coincidence?
